NEW YORK, Dec. 12 -- PEN America issued the following news release:
Twenty-nine organizations and PEN centers have signed on to an open letter led by PEN America's Artists at Risk Connection (ARC), PEN International, and the PEN Cuban Writers in Exile Center, calling on the Cuban government and State-influenced outlets to immediately cease all efforts aimed at discrediting the renowned Cuban multidisciplinary artist, Tania Bruguera, and the IV INSTAR Film Festival.
